Package step.artefacts.handlers
Class RetryIfFailsHandler
- java.lang.Object
-
- step.core.artefacts.handlers.ArtefactHandler<RetryIfFails,RetryIfFailsReportNode>
-
- step.artefacts.handlers.RetryIfFailsHandler
-
public class RetryIfFailsHandler extends ArtefactHandler<RetryIfFails,RetryIfFailsReportNode>
-
-
Field Summary
-
Fields inherited from class step.core.artefacts.handlers.ArtefactHandler
context, CONTINUE_EXECUTION, CONTINUE_EXECUTION_ONCE, FILE_VARIABLE_PREFIX, logger, reportNodeAttachmentManager, reportNodeAttributesManager
-
-
Constructor Summary
Constructors Constructor Description RetryIfFailsHandler()
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description RetryIfFailsReportNode
createReportNode_(ReportNode parentNode, RetryIfFails testArtefact)
protected void
createReportSkeleton_(RetryIfFailsReportNode parentNode, RetryIfFails testArtefact)
protected void
execute_(RetryIfFailsReportNode node, RetryIfFails testArtefact)
-
Methods inherited from class step.core.artefacts.handlers.ArtefactHandler
addReportNodeUpdateListener, asBoolean, asInteger, asInteger, createReportSkeleton, createWorkArtefact, createWorkArtefact, createWorkArtefact, delegateCreateReportSkeleton, delegateCreateReportSkeleton, delegateCreateReportSkeleton, delegateExecute, delegateExecute, delegateExecute, execute, fail, failWithException, failWithException, failWithException, getBindings, getChildren, getChildren, init, isInSession, releaseTokens, removeReportNode, saveReportNode
-
-
-
-
Method Detail
-
createReportSkeleton_
protected void createReportSkeleton_(RetryIfFailsReportNode parentNode, RetryIfFails testArtefact)
- Specified by:
createReportSkeleton_
in classArtefactHandler<RetryIfFails,RetryIfFailsReportNode>
-
execute_
protected void execute_(RetryIfFailsReportNode node, RetryIfFails testArtefact)
- Specified by:
execute_
in classArtefactHandler<RetryIfFails,RetryIfFailsReportNode>
-
createReportNode_
public RetryIfFailsReportNode createReportNode_(ReportNode parentNode, RetryIfFails testArtefact)
- Specified by:
createReportNode_
in classArtefactHandler<RetryIfFails,RetryIfFailsReportNode>
-
-